What Plug Type I Look For
In Switzerland, I need to look for a plug that fits Type J sockets. This is the standard plug type used there. I also check whether my own devices use plugs from the US, UK, EU, or elsewhere, because the adapter I choose must match both my device plug and the Swiss outlet.
How I Check Voltage Compatibility
Before I buy an adapter, I always check the voltage rating of my electronics. Switzerland uses 230V power and 50Hz frequency. If my device is dual-voltage, I can usually use it with just an adapter. If it is not dual-voltage, I may need a voltage converter as well. I never assume an adapter alone will protect my device.

Features I Look For Before Buying
When I shop for a travel adapter, I pay attention to these features:
- Compatibility: I make sure it supports Swiss Type J outlets.
- USB ports: I prefer adapters with USB-A or USB-C ports so I can charge multiple devices.
- Compact size: I want something lightweight and easy to pack.
- Safety features: I look for surge protection and built-in safety shutters.
- Durability: I choose a model that feels sturdy for frequent travel.
